MPX5082152: 58 year old Charlie Roberts of Eastbourne, Sussex is proud of his pumpkin growing prowess. He challenges any amateur gardener to better his record of over 500lbs weight of pumpkins grown from 6 plants. He was helped to grow this weight by a freak second crop, the first normal crop of 11 pumpkins from his 6 plants weighted in at 400lbs. When he returned from a fortnight's holiday, the second crop had started growing due to the Indian summer. Early in November he cut 8 more pumpkins which brought the total to over 500lbs - and Charlie Reckons a record. November 1969 / Bridgeman Images
